What is retinol?

Retinol, also known as all-trans-Retinol, is a member of the vitamin A family. In the skin care industry, retinol has been given the reputation of "all-rounder of skin care". This is mainly because of its powerful functions. Ordinary skin care ingredients are more targeted. Usually, there is only one effect on the skin, and few have more than three effects on the skin like retinol.

Retinol is one of the most effective active molecules in cosmetic anti-aging formulations and is respected by skin care experts and consumers around the world. It is widely used to improve a series of skin problems such as pores, fine lines, wrinkles, spots, and dullness. It has also been used to care for acne-prone skin. It has the reputation of "skin care all-rounder" and "anti-aging gold standard" , in recent years, there has even been a skin care trend of "C in the morning and A in the evening".

Retinol, or vitamin A, is a fat-soluble vitamin that can only be absorbed through exogenous sources and is necessary for the human body. The human diet contains two main sources of vitamin A: meat and vegetables. After vitamin A enters the body, part of it is utilized and metabolized, and the other part is stored in various organs, mainly the liver.

Common retinol and its derivatives in the human body include: retinol (A alcohol), retinal (A aldehyde), retinoic acid (retinoic acid, A acid) and retinyl ester (A ester). The above are collectively called the retinoid family, which have similar chemical structures and biological activities and can be transformed into each other.

What are the benefits for the skin?

The main effect of retinol on the skin is to help the stratum corneum of the skin restore normal metabolism, thicken the stratum corneum of the skin, and enhance the water storage capacity of the skin; in addition, it can also promote the production of collagen in the dermis of the skin.

 

1. Refine pores

Retinol can promote the normal differentiation of skin keratinocytes, so it can make the distribution of keratinocytes more compact, so using retinol skin care products, the pores will become more delicate and the skin will become firmer and smoother.

2. Anti-aging and anti-wrinkle

On the one hand, retinol can prevent the decomposition of dermal collagen and reduce wrinkles; on the other hand, it can promote the synthesis of dermal collagen to improve and lighten wrinkles.

3. Acne

Relevant studies have shown that retinol has an anti-inflammatory effect on the skin, which can inhibit the secretion of sebum in the hair follicles, improve the accumulation of keratin in the pores, and prevent the pores from being blocked, so the acne-removing effect is obvious.

4. Whitening

Retinol can accelerate the metabolism of keratinocytes and inhibit the production of melanin, so when used together with skin care products containing whitening ingredients, the effect will be even higher.

5.Retinol's target

 

In the skin, retinol is naturally present in the epidermis and increases in concentration from the stratum corneum to the basal layer. Retinyl ester is the storage form of retinol in keratinocytes, which can be converted into retinol and further into retinoic acid when needed to maintain dynamic balance. Its biological targets have been fully studied at the molecular level, mainly through binding to specific nuclear receptors to initiate specific gene regulation.

Retinol's target

Since retinol itself cannot directly bind to nuclear receptors, the currently widely accepted theory is that retinol needs to undergo a series of oxidation reactions in cells to convert it into retinoic acid before it can further exert its effects. After retinol enters cells, it will widely increase the expression of alcohol dehydrogenase (ADH) and be oxidized into retinal, which can more selectively bind to retinal dehydrogenase (RALDH) to thereby Oxidized to retinoic acid. Retinol exists in different isomeric forms: trans-retinol and cis-retinol. Only trans-retinol (which makes up the majority in most tissues) is the active form that is converted into retinoic acid.

In what fields is it applied?

Due to its key physiological functions and multi-target mechanism of action, the retinoid family is widely used in the fields of medicine and cosmetics. In most countries and regions, retinoic acid is an ingredient in prescription drugs, while retinol, retinaldehyde and retinyl esters are ingredients in over-the-counter drugs, medical skin care products and cosmetics.

 

Medical field: Topical or oral treatment of a variety of local or systemic diseases, including dietary supplementation to treat vitamin A deficiency or malabsorption, promote corneal healing, treat abnormal keratosis (psoriasis, ichthyosis, etc.), improve acne and photoaging wait.

Cosmetics field: Retinol is an anti-aging ingredient that can be added to cosmetics. Its application can be traced back to the early 20th century. Since the 1990s, major cosmetics groups have invested a lot of research and development efforts to develop retinoids that meet cosmetic specifications. Ingredients, protect their patents, and make full use of professional knowledge and experience to optimize the formula in terms of active ingredient synergy and formula stability. Today, retinoid ingredients used as anti-aging ingredients in cosmetics mainly include retinol, retinyl acetate, retinyl palmitate and retinaldehyde. The first three have been approved by the European Scientific Committee on Consumer Safety (SCCS). ) recognized as safe ingredients; the latest applications also include: hydroxypinacolone retinoate (HPR), retinoid ingredient compatibility, plant-derived retinoid substitutes, etc.

Applying proteomic methods to study the skin action mechanism of retinol

 

Proteomics is a method for comprehensive identification of all protein content in an organ, tissue or cell line at a specific time point and under conditions. Compared with genomics and transcriptomics, it can more directly reflect changes in functional proteins and correlate with phenotypes. It may be more directly related. At the same time, it can provide an overall understanding of all biological functions carried by proteins and help establish important biological markers.

Through proteomic research, L'Oréal scientists obtained 220 proteins related to retinol and 227 proteins related to retinoic acid, of which 164 proteins were highly overlapping, and the regulation patterns (up-regulation or down-regulation) were highly consistent (Figure 4). The functional classification of these proteins can be classified into six major categories: energy metabolism, protein synthesis, glycolysis, wound healing, defense and skin barrier function, of which the first three are new discoveries. The analysis believes that increasing energy metabolism and energy supply, accompanied by an increase in protein synthesis, is consistent with the clinical effect of retinol on increasing epidermal thickness and improving skin quality.

Using multiphoton microscopy imaging technology to observe the skin effects of retinol

Multiphoton microscopy imaging technology can avoid invasive biopsies and observe the structure of skin tissue. It can not only perform plain scans, but also obtain clear and sharp longitudinal sections, and even observe three-dimensional solid structures through modeling. Utilizes endogenous multi-photon signals to display characteristic molecular and structural information of the epidermis and superficial dermis with resolutions up to sub-micron level. With 3D image processing tools, different layers of skin can be automatically layered and their quantitative parameters extracted and analyzed. Multiphoton microscopy imaging technology can well reveal the characteristics of skin pigmentation, skin aging or photoaging, skin diseases such as melanoma, and can also be used to evaluate the skin permeability and efficacy of drugs and cosmetics.

Using multiphoton microscopy imaging technology, scientists observed the skin effects of topical use of 0.3% retinol and 0.025% Vitamin A acid for more than one year. The results showed that after one year of using retinol, the epidermal thickness increased significantly by up to 30%, the undulation of the dermal-epidermal junction also increased slightly but not significantly, and the density and longitudinal distribution of epidermal melanin were also significantly improved. The latter may be used as a It is an early sensitive indicator of photoaging. In addition, the cosmetic formula 0.3% retinol has similar or even more significant effects than the topical drug formula 0.025% retinoic acid.

Benefit

Retinol is currently the most widely used and well-known star player. It also has a good effect. Vitamin A alcohol is a fat-soluble component, which can penetrate the stratum corneum and reach the dermis.

The effective concentration of retinol is about 0.1%. Experimental results also showed that 0.1% retinol had a significant improvement in fine lines and wrinkles, hyperpigmentation, elasticity, firmness and overall photodamage after eight weeks of use

The concentration reached 0.4%, even in a self-controlled test on the inner upper arm of an average age of 87, after 24 weeks of continuous use. It can also significantly reduce the wrinkles that have already formed, which is also the optimal concentration of retinol. No matter how high the concentration is, the irritation will increase significantly, and the effect will not be good.
